
Building Odisha’s Green Workforce: Jobs, Skills and Entrepreneurship Opportunities for the Green Economy
Odisha’s transition to a low-carbon, climate-resilient economy is creating significant opportunities for jobs and entrepreneurship across energy, industry, environment and emerging green sectors.
Our upcoming report highlights the scale of employment opportunities emerging from the energy transition, environmental action and climate response and the need to equip Odisha’s workforce with the skills and competencies to seize these opportunities. The near-term opportunity is already visible: The state’s announced RE targets could support approximately 29,400 jobs by 2030 and will nearly double by 2035 (to over 57,000). Besides, the state’s green investment pipeline (approved until 2025), could generate additionally over 48,400 jobs across emerging green industries.
The launch will bring together government, industry, academia, skilling institutions, development partners and civil society to discuss emerging green employment opportunities, changing skill and competency requirements, and pathways for building Odisha’s green workforce.
